These rules are framed to prevent the taking up of land, which properly is held or occupied by native Nicobarese. Registers are to be maintained-(1) of land within a twomiles radius from the jetty at Nancoury, (2) beyond that distance, and (3) register of transfers. The conditions of licenses (endorsed on each license) vary according as the land is within the two-miles radius or beyond it. In the latter case no rent or revenue is charged for fifteen years; after that one rupee per acre is payable annually1. In the Nicobars the land measure used is the acre of 43,568 square feet, which is divided into fractions called 'one auna, or one pio' re spectively. The 'anna' is the onesixteenth part (2722 square feet) and the pie the twelfth of that (226 9 square foot). INDEX OF SUBJECTS.
